Primary diagnostics: checking simple causes

Before grabbing the tools, it is necessary to eliminate common operating errors. Often the reason lies not in a breakdown of the electronics, but in the incorrect placement of products or a leak in the seal. Carefully inspect the internal space: do not the products block air ductsthrough which cold air flows from top to bottom or circulates through the chamber.

Pay attention to the rubber door seal. If it is dirty, deformed, or simply does not fit tightly, warm air from the room enters the chamber. Compressor begins to wear out, trying to compensate for heat loss, but the upper shelves still remain warm. Wipe the seal with a soft cloth and check the tightness around the entire perimeter.

It is also worth checking the thermostat settings. Perhaps one of the household members accidentally moved the lever or changed the digital parameters. Make sure that the installed mode complies with the manufacturer's recommendations. For most models, the optimal temperature in the main chamber is considered to be from +3 to +5 degrees.

⚠️ Attention: If you notice that the door seal has cracks or creases, simple cleaning will not help. Deformed rubber must be replaced, otherwise the cold will disappear constantly, and ice will form on the walls of the chamber.

Problems with the thermostat and temperature sensors

One of the most common reasons why the top of the refrigerator does not cool is the failure of thermostat (thermostat). This device is responsible for turning the compressor on and off depending on the temperature inside the chamber. If the sensor “lies” and reports that there is already cold, the compressor simply will not start, and the temperature will begin to rise.

In modern models with electronic control, the thermostat function is performed temperature sensors (NTC thermistors). There may be several of them: one controls the air in the chamber, the other controls the temperature of the evaporator. If the air sensor in the refrigerator compartment fails, the control unit will not receive a signal about the need for cooling. Diagnostics of such elements requires a multimeter to measure resistance.

Symptoms of a malfunctioning thermostat or sensor are often accompanied by the fact that the refrigerator either does not turn on at all, or works nonstop, but does not cool. In some cases, temporarily closing the thermostat contacts (for mechanical models) helps, which allows you to start the compressor directly and check its performance.

Malfunctions of the defrost system in No Frost refrigerators

In units with a system No Frost the situation when the freezer is working, but the refrigerator compartment is warm, often indicates problems with the defrost system. A “coat” of ice builds up on the evaporator, which is usually hidden behind the back wall. This ice blocks the operation of the fan, and cold air physically cannot enter the upper part of the chamber.

Three key elements are responsible for the defrosting process: Defrost heating element, a defrost sensor and a timer (or electronic control module). If the heating element burns out, the ice does not melt. If the sensor is faulty, it does not give a command to turn on the heating. As a result, the blower fan either stops due to freezing, or drives warm air, since the evaporator is completely blocked by ice.

To confirm the diagnosis, partial disassembly of the refrigerator is often required. It is necessary to remove the back panel in the freezer and visually assess the condition of the evaporator. If it is covered with a thick layer of frost or ice, and the fan does not spin or spins with difficulty, the problem is in the defrosting system.

Freon leak and problems with the compressor

A more serious reason for the lack of cold is a refrigerant leak (freon) or a malfunction of the compressor itself. If a hole has formed in the system, the gas gradually evaporates, and its quantity is no longer sufficient for effective cooling, especially in areas remote from the evaporator - that is, on the upper shelves.

When freon leaks, you can often notice that the condenser grill (at the back of the refrigerator) heats up unevenly or remains cold. In this case, the compressor can work continuously, trying to increase the temperature, but the characteristic gurgling or hissing in the tubes is not heard. In some cases, traces of oil are visible on the tubes - this is a clear sign of depressurization.

If the compressor hums, clicks, but does not start, or starts for a few seconds and turns off, the problem may be in the starting relay or in the windings of the motor itself. In this case, a professional replacement of the unit is required, since repairing the compressor is not economically feasible.

Clogged capillary pipeline or filter drier

There are narrow areas in the refrigerant circulation system that are sensitive to contaminants. Capillary tube and the filter drier can become clogged with oil oxidation products or moisture entering the circuit. This creates a so-called “oil blockage” or “ice plug.”

With such a defect, the circulation of freon is disrupted. The compressor tries to push the gas, the pressure at the outlet increases and the pressure at the inlet drops. As a result, the evaporator in the refrigerator compartment (or its upper part) stops cooling, while the condenser may be hot. This is often accompanied by uncharacteristic noise during operation.

Removing a blockage is a complex technical procedure. It requires evacuation of the system, purging with nitrogen and replacing the filter drier. It is impossible to do this work independently without special equipment (vacuum pump, pressure gauge station).

When you need to call a specialist

There are a number of situations when independent repair is not only useless, but also dangerous. If you detect a freon leak, the smell of burnt wiring, or hear that the compressor is operating with strong vibration and knocking, it is better not to risk it. Professional diagnostics in such cases, you will save money and nerves.

A master is also needed if a compressor replacement, circuit sealing, or complex electronic diagnostics of the control module is required. These works require a license, special tools and knowledge of electrical safety. An attempt to replace the compressor yourself may result in electric shock or fire.

In addition, if the refrigerator is under warranty, any intervention in the design (removing seals, disassembling components) will lead to loss of warranty rights. In this case, the only correct solution is to contact an authorized service center.

⚠️ Attention: Freon used in modern refrigerators, although considered safe for the ozone layer, can displace oxygen in high concentrations. If a leak is detected (hissing, oil stains), ensure the room is ventilated and do not use open fire near the equipment.

Prevention and proper care of equipment

To avoid situations where the top of the refrigerator stops cooling, it is important to follow the operating rules. Regular defrosting (for drip systems) and cleaning the drainage hole prevents the formation of ice plugs. Do not place hot food in the chamber - this creates unnecessary load on the system.

Keep the condenser grill at the back of the refrigerator clean. Dust, animal hair and fluff act as a heat insulator, preventing heat dissipation. This forces compressor to work longer and more intensely, which reduces its resource. It is recommended to vacuum the grille once every six months.

Do not overload the refrigerator with food. Cold air should circulate freely inside. If the shelves are jam-packed, especially at the back wall where the cold supply channels are located, the upper zone will remain warm, even if the unit is working properly.

Why in a two-chamber refrigerator can cold only be lost in the upper compartment?

In two-chamber models with one compressor, the cold is often generated in the freezer compartment and then distributed to the refrigerator. If the air circulation is disrupted (the duct is frozen, the fan is broken) or the system is partially clogged, the cold will only be enough for the evaporator in the freezer, and it will not reach the top of the refrigerator compartment.

Is it possible to operate a refrigerator if it does not cool well, but the food has not yet spoiled?

Long-term operation in this mode is extremely undesirable. The compressor will work at its limit, which will lead to its overheating and eventual breakdown. In addition, bacteria can begin to multiply in the heat, even if food spoilage is not yet visible visually.

How to quickly defrost a refrigerator for testing?

To completely defrost, you need to turn off the appliance from the mains, open the doors and leave for at least 24 hours. It is strictly forbidden to speed up the process with a hair dryer or hot water - a sharp temperature change can damage plastic parts and even cause cracks in the evaporator.

Does the location of the refrigerator affect the quality of cooling?

Yes, it does directly. If the refrigerator is standing close to the wall or in a niche without gaps, heat transfer is disrupted. The capacitor does not give off heat, efficiency decreases. Gaps of 5-10 cm are required on all sides, especially at the back and sides.
